Competition
The rivalry among businesses or individuals for dominance or a greater share of the market or attention, often leading to innovation and better choices for consumers.
Monopolist
An individual or entity that holds a dominant position or exclusive control over a market or supply of a particular commodity or service.
Market Size
The total volume of sales or potential sales of a product or service within a particular market.
Tying Arrangement
A seller’s act of conditioning the sale of a product or service on the buyer’s agreement to purchase another product or service from the seller.
